Why Cleanliness Matters for Airbnb Hosts

Cleanliness is one of the most important factors for guests when booking an Airbnb. In fact, it is often one of the top reasons for both positive and negative reviews. According to Airbnb’s data, guests frequently mention cleanliness in reviews—both when they’re satisfied and when they’re dissatisfied. As a host, maintaining a clean and comfortable environment can directly influence:

  1. Guest Satisfaction and Reviews
    Guests expect a spotless space when they check in. If your property is clean, organized, and well-maintained, guests are more likely to leave glowing reviews. Positive reviews increase your credibility as a host and help build your reputation, which leads to more bookings. Conversely, negative reviews about cleanliness can tarnish your reputation and make it harder to attract future guests.
  2. Booking Frequency
    A clean property leads to higher demand and repeat bookings. Guests tend to choose properties that have great cleanliness ratings. If your Airbnb is always spotless, you’ll have higher chances of getting booked over others that may have lower cleanliness ratings.
  3. Health and Safety
    Airbnb cleanliness in Sydney also ties directly into the health and safety of your guests. A poorly cleaned property may harbor allergens, bacteria, and other harmful contaminants that could lead to health issues. A clean property ensures that your guests stay healthy during their stay, and it’s an essential part of being a responsible host.

How Professional Cleaning Enhances Your Airbnb Experience

While you can certainly clean your Airbnb on your own, there are several reasons why hiring professional cleaning services can enhance the guest experience and streamline your hosting process.

1. Time-Saving

As an Airbnb host, you likely have a busy schedule, especially if you have multiple properties or if you’re managing your property on top of other commitments. Cleaning an Airbnb properly requires significant time and attention to detail, which could take hours of your day—time that could be spent answering guest inquiries, marketing your property, or managing bookings. Professional cleaning services can take this responsibility off your plate, ensuring that your property is cleaned thoroughly without you needing to invest hours of work.

2. Consistency in Cleaning Quality

Professional cleaning services are experts in maintaining cleanliness. They know the best techniques for cleaning different surfaces, handling linens, and dealing with difficult spots. By using professional services, you’re ensuring that every guest experiences the same high-quality standard of cleanliness, no matter when they stay. Consistency is key to making your guests feel comfortable and ensuring that their expectations are met every time.

3. Attention to Detail

One of the biggest advantages of working with professional cleaners is their attention to detail. They’re trained to spot issues you may overlook, such as stains on carpets, dust in corners, or dirty windows. Their expertise ensures that all areas of the property are spotless, including areas that are often neglected during a regular clean, like high-touch surfaces, vents, and behind furniture.

4. Specialized Equipment and Cleaning Products

Professional cleaning companies have access to specialized cleaning equipment and products that you may not have at home. From commercial-grade vacuums to deep-cleaning tools, these companies can use equipment that ensures a higher level of cleanliness. Moreover, they typically use environmentally friendly, non-toxic products that are safe for both guests and the environment.

5. Faster Turnaround Between Guests

With back-to-back bookings, especially in busy seasons, the time between guests can be tight. Professional cleaning services are skilled in performing thorough cleanings quickly and efficiently. They know how to manage their time effectively, ensuring that your property is ready for the next guest in the shortest possible time.

Creating a Seamless Airbnb Experience with Professional Cleaning: Best Practices

Now that we’ve discussed the importance of cleanliness and how professional cleaning can enhance the guest experience, let’s look at best practices for creating a seamless Airbnb experience using cleaning services.

1. Establish a Cleaning Schedule

A well-defined cleaning schedule is essential for ensuring that your Airbnb property stays in top shape. With professional cleaning services, you should:

  • Set a Standard Cleaning Frequency
    Depending on your property’s booking schedule, you should establish a cleaning routine. For example, for an Airbnb that books frequently, you may need professional cleaning services after every guest check-out. If your property has longer gaps between bookings, you can opt for weekly or bi-weekly cleaning. The key is to maintain a consistent schedule that ensures your property is always guest-ready.
  • Clean After Each Check-Out
    After every guest checks out, a thorough cleaning should take place. This includes changing the linens, cleaning the bathroom, dusting all surfaces, vacuuming, and ensuring that no traces of previous guests remain. This type of cleaning helps to reset the space and make sure the next guest feels like they are the first person to stay in the property.
  • Deep Cleaning Periodically
    While standard cleaning is done after each guest, it’s important to schedule deep cleaning at regular intervals—perhaps once a month or every couple of months. This includes cleaning the carpets, washing the windows, sanitizing the kitchen appliances, and checking for any issues that may need attention.

2. Communicate Expectations Clearly

When working with a professional cleaning service, it’s important to communicate your expectations clearly. A good cleaning service will want to know your specific requirements and any areas of the property that require extra attention.

  • Provide a Checklist
    You can create a cleaning checklist for the cleaning service to follow. This checklist should include tasks such as:
    • Changing and washing linens
    • Cleaning and disinfecting the bathroom
    • Dusting all surfaces (including shelves, counters, and furniture)
    • Cleaning the floors and vacuuming
    • Sanitizing high-touch areas such as doorknobs, light switches, and remotes
    • Cleaning the windows and mirrors
    • Emptying trash bins
    • Checking for any damage or maintenance issues
  • This ensures that the cleaning service doesn’t miss any important details, which can lead to an improved guest experience.

3. Use a Professional Cleaning Service with Experience in Airbnb Properties

Not all cleaning companies are equipped to handle the specific needs of an Airbnb property. When choosing a cleaning service, look for one with experience in short-term rental properties. These companies will understand the unique demands of Airbnb cleaning, such as the fast turnaround between guests, high cleanliness standards, and attention to detail. They will also be familiar with handling linens and dealing with items like towels, bedding, and toiletries.

4. Ensure Quality Control

Even with professional cleaners, it’s important to do a quick quality check after each cleaning. This helps catch any issues that may have been missed or require extra attention. Walk through the property and check the following:

  • Are the linens fresh and properly folded?
  • Is the bathroom spotless, with fresh towels and toiletries?
  • Is there any dust or dirt left on furniture, counters, or floors?
  • Are high-touch surfaces properly sanitized?

If there are any issues, you can address them before the next guest arrives. Having a set process for quality control will ensure your property consistently meets the cleanliness standards your guests expect.

5. Make Use of Guest Feedback

Guest reviews provide valuable feedback, especially when it comes to cleanliness. If guests leave comments about cleanliness—positive or negative—take the time to address them. For example, if guests note that the property was exceptionally clean, thank them for the feedback and continue to use the same cleaning methods. If there are any complaints, such as an area not being cleaned properly, use that as an opportunity to fine-tune your cleaning procedures.

6. Offer Extra Touches for a Higher Standard of Cleanliness

A clean property goes beyond just surfaces. Offering extra touches can create an elevated experience for your guests:

  • Stocking High-Quality Toiletries
    Offering luxury toiletries, like high-end shampoo, conditioner, and soap, shows guests that you care about their comfort and adds an extra level of luxury to the cleanliness of your property.
  • Fresh Towels and Linens
    Providing freshly laundered linens and towels for each guest adds to the overall cleanliness of the property and gives guests a feeling of freshness.
  • Creating a Fresh Scent
    A clean, pleasant scent in your property can make a big difference in the overall experience. Consider using air fresheners or diffusers with a light, fresh scent to make the property smell inviting.
